Skip site navigation (1)Skip section navigation (2)
Date:      Thu, 26 Mar 2020 04:51:41 +0000 (UTC)
From:      Tobias Kortkamp <tobik@FreeBSD.org>
To:        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org
Subject:   svn commit: r529162 - in head/x11-themes/plasma5-breeze-gtk: . files
Message-ID:  <202003260451.02Q4pfHU053489@repo.freebsd.org>

next in thread | raw e-mail | index | archive | help
Author: tobik
Date: Thu Mar 26 04:51:41 2020
New Revision: 529162
URL: https://svnweb.freebsd.org/changeset/ports/529162

Log:
  x11-themes/plasma5-breeze-gtk: Fix invisible radio buttons and checkboxes
  
  Their assets were not installed in the right place due to differences
  between our cp and GNU cp.
  
  - While here add NO_ARCH
  
  PR:		244970
  Submitted by:	timon@timon.net.nz
  Reported by:	Bengt Ahlgren <bengta@sics.se>
  Approved by:	kde (tcberner)

Added:
  head/x11-themes/plasma5-breeze-gtk/files/
  head/x11-themes/plasma5-breeze-gtk/files/patch-src_build__theme.sh   (contents, props changed)
Modified:
  head/x11-themes/plasma5-breeze-gtk/Makefile
  head/x11-themes/plasma5-breeze-gtk/pkg-plist

Modified: head/x11-themes/plasma5-breeze-gtk/Makefile
==============================================================================
--- head/x11-themes/plasma5-breeze-gtk/Makefile	Thu Mar 26 04:40:22 2020	(r529161)
+++ head/x11-themes/plasma5-breeze-gtk/Makefile	Thu Mar 26 04:51:41 2020	(r529162)
@@ -2,6 +2,7 @@
 
 PORTNAME=	breeze-gtk
 DISTVERSION=	${KDE_PLASMA_VERSION}
+PORTREVISION=	1
 CATEGORIES=	x11-themes kde kde-plasma
 
 MAINTAINER=	kde@FreeBSD.org
@@ -21,5 +22,6 @@ USE_KDE=	breeze ecm
 USE_QT=		core buildtools_build qmake_build
 
 BINARY_ALIAS=	python3=${PYTHON_VERSION}
+NO_ARCH=	yes
 
 .include <bsd.port.mk>

Added: head/x11-themes/plasma5-breeze-gtk/files/patch-src_build__theme.sh
==============================================================================
--- /dev/null	00:00:00 1970	(empty, because file is newly added)
+++ head/x11-themes/plasma5-breeze-gtk/files/patch-src_build__theme.sh	Thu Mar 26 04:51:41 2020	(r529162)
@@ -0,0 +1,8 @@
+--- src/build_theme.sh.orig	2020-03-10 12:54:51 UTC
++++ src/build_theme.sh
+@@ -109,4 +109,4 @@ fi
+ 
+ render_theme "${COLOR_SCHEME}" "${THEME_NAME}" "${INSTALL_TARGET}" "${COLOR_SCHEME_ROOT}/Breeze.colors"
+ [ -z "${INSTALL_TARGET}" ] && INSTALL_TARGET="${HOME}/.local/share/themes/${THEME_NAME}"
+-cp -r assets/ "${INSTALL_TARGET}"
++cp -r assets "${INSTALL_TARGET}"

Modified: head/x11-themes/plasma5-breeze-gtk/pkg-plist
==============================================================================
--- head/x11-themes/plasma5-breeze-gtk/pkg-plist	Thu Mar 26 04:40:22 2020	(r529161)
+++ head/x11-themes/plasma5-breeze-gtk/pkg-plist	Thu Mar 26 04:51:41 2020	(r529162)
@@ -30,6 +30,24 @@ share/themes/Breeze-Dark/assets/arrow-up-active.png
 share/themes/Breeze-Dark/assets/arrow-up-hover.png
 share/themes/Breeze-Dark/assets/arrow-up-insensitive.png
 share/themes/Breeze-Dark/assets/arrow-up.png
+share/themes/Breeze-Dark/assets/breeze-check-checked-symbolic.svg
+share/themes/Breeze-Dark/assets/breeze-check-indeterminate-symbolic.svg
+share/themes/Breeze-Dark/assets/breeze-check-unchecked-symbolic.svg
+share/themes/Breeze-Dark/assets/breeze-close-active-symbolic.svg
+share/themes/Breeze-Dark/assets/breeze-close-hover-symbolic.svg
+share/themes/Breeze-Dark/assets/breeze-close-symbolic.svg
+share/themes/Breeze-Dark/assets/breeze-maximize-active-symbolic.svg
+share/themes/Breeze-Dark/assets/breeze-maximize-hover-symbolic.svg
+share/themes/Breeze-Dark/assets/breeze-maximize-symbolic.svg
+share/themes/Breeze-Dark/assets/breeze-maximized-active-symbolic.svg
+share/themes/Breeze-Dark/assets/breeze-maximized-hover-symbolic.svg
+share/themes/Breeze-Dark/assets/breeze-maximized-symbolic.svg
+share/themes/Breeze-Dark/assets/breeze-minimize-active-symbolic.svg
+share/themes/Breeze-Dark/assets/breeze-minimize-hover-symbolic.svg
+share/themes/Breeze-Dark/assets/breeze-minimize-symbolic.svg
+share/themes/Breeze-Dark/assets/breeze-radio-checked-symbolic.svg
+share/themes/Breeze-Dark/assets/breeze-radio-indeterminate-symbolic.svg
+share/themes/Breeze-Dark/assets/breeze-radio-unchecked-symbolic.svg
 share/themes/Breeze-Dark/assets/button-active.png
 share/themes/Breeze-Dark/assets/button-hover.png
 share/themes/Breeze-Dark/assets/button-insensitive.png
@@ -243,24 +261,6 @@ share/themes/Breeze-Dark/assets/toolbutton-active.png
 share/themes/Breeze-Dark/assets/toolbutton-hover.png
 share/themes/Breeze-Dark/assets/toolbutton-toggled.png
 share/themes/Breeze-Dark/assets/tree-header.png
-share/themes/Breeze-Dark/breeze-check-checked-symbolic.svg
-share/themes/Breeze-Dark/breeze-check-indeterminate-symbolic.svg
-share/themes/Breeze-Dark/breeze-check-unchecked-symbolic.svg
-share/themes/Breeze-Dark/breeze-close-active-symbolic.svg
-share/themes/Breeze-Dark/breeze-close-hover-symbolic.svg
-share/themes/Breeze-Dark/breeze-close-symbolic.svg
-share/themes/Breeze-Dark/breeze-maximize-active-symbolic.svg
-share/themes/Breeze-Dark/breeze-maximize-hover-symbolic.svg
-share/themes/Breeze-Dark/breeze-maximize-symbolic.svg
-share/themes/Breeze-Dark/breeze-maximized-active-symbolic.svg
-share/themes/Breeze-Dark/breeze-maximized-hover-symbolic.svg
-share/themes/Breeze-Dark/breeze-maximized-symbolic.svg
-share/themes/Breeze-Dark/breeze-minimize-active-symbolic.svg
-share/themes/Breeze-Dark/breeze-minimize-hover-symbolic.svg
-share/themes/Breeze-Dark/breeze-minimize-symbolic.svg
-share/themes/Breeze-Dark/breeze-radio-checked-symbolic.svg
-share/themes/Breeze-Dark/breeze-radio-indeterminate-symbolic.svg
-share/themes/Breeze-Dark/breeze-radio-unchecked-symbolic.svg
 share/themes/Breeze-Dark/gtk-2.0/gtkrc
 share/themes/Breeze-Dark/gtk-2.0/widgets/buttons
 share/themes/Breeze-Dark/gtk-2.0/widgets/default
@@ -306,6 +306,24 @@ share/themes/Breeze/assets/arrow-up-active.png
 share/themes/Breeze/assets/arrow-up-hover.png
 share/themes/Breeze/assets/arrow-up-insensitive.png
 share/themes/Breeze/assets/arrow-up.png
+share/themes/Breeze/assets/breeze-check-checked-symbolic.svg
+share/themes/Breeze/assets/breeze-check-indeterminate-symbolic.svg
+share/themes/Breeze/assets/breeze-check-unchecked-symbolic.svg
+share/themes/Breeze/assets/breeze-close-active-symbolic.svg
+share/themes/Breeze/assets/breeze-close-hover-symbolic.svg
+share/themes/Breeze/assets/breeze-close-symbolic.svg
+share/themes/Breeze/assets/breeze-maximize-active-symbolic.svg
+share/themes/Breeze/assets/breeze-maximize-hover-symbolic.svg
+share/themes/Breeze/assets/breeze-maximize-symbolic.svg
+share/themes/Breeze/assets/breeze-maximized-active-symbolic.svg
+share/themes/Breeze/assets/breeze-maximized-hover-symbolic.svg
+share/themes/Breeze/assets/breeze-maximized-symbolic.svg
+share/themes/Breeze/assets/breeze-minimize-active-symbolic.svg
+share/themes/Breeze/assets/breeze-minimize-hover-symbolic.svg
+share/themes/Breeze/assets/breeze-minimize-symbolic.svg
+share/themes/Breeze/assets/breeze-radio-checked-symbolic.svg
+share/themes/Breeze/assets/breeze-radio-indeterminate-symbolic.svg
+share/themes/Breeze/assets/breeze-radio-unchecked-symbolic.svg
 share/themes/Breeze/assets/button-active.png
 share/themes/Breeze/assets/button-hover.png
 share/themes/Breeze/assets/button-insensitive.png
@@ -519,24 +537,6 @@ share/themes/Breeze/assets/toolbutton-active.png
 share/themes/Breeze/assets/toolbutton-hover.png
 share/themes/Breeze/assets/toolbutton-toggled.png
 share/themes/Breeze/assets/tree-header.png
-share/themes/Breeze/breeze-check-checked-symbolic.svg
-share/themes/Breeze/breeze-check-indeterminate-symbolic.svg
-share/themes/Breeze/breeze-check-unchecked-symbolic.svg
-share/themes/Breeze/breeze-close-active-symbolic.svg
-share/themes/Breeze/breeze-close-hover-symbolic.svg
-share/themes/Breeze/breeze-close-symbolic.svg
-share/themes/Breeze/breeze-maximize-active-symbolic.svg
-share/themes/Breeze/breeze-maximize-hover-symbolic.svg
-share/themes/Breeze/breeze-maximize-symbolic.svg
-share/themes/Breeze/breeze-maximized-active-symbolic.svg
-share/themes/Breeze/breeze-maximized-hover-symbolic.svg
-share/themes/Breeze/breeze-maximized-symbolic.svg
-share/themes/Breeze/breeze-minimize-active-symbolic.svg
-share/themes/Breeze/breeze-minimize-hover-symbolic.svg
-share/themes/Breeze/breeze-minimize-symbolic.svg
-share/themes/Breeze/breeze-radio-checked-symbolic.svg
-share/themes/Breeze/breeze-radio-indeterminate-symbolic.svg
-share/themes/Breeze/breeze-radio-unchecked-symbolic.svg
 share/themes/Breeze/gtk-2.0/gtkrc
 share/themes/Breeze/gtk-2.0/widgets/buttons
 share/themes/Breeze/gtk-2.0/widgets/default



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?202003260451.02Q4pfHU053489>